Maximizing Every Inch: Smart Furniture Choices
Multitasking Furniture is Your Best Friend
Pro Tips:
- Grab a storage bed that hides clutter underneath
- Pick an ottoman with secret storage compartments
- Invest in a wall-mounted desk that disappears when not in use
Layout Tricks That Create Space
I learned the hard way that how you place furniture matters more than how much furniture you have. Some game-changing moves:
- Tuck your bed into a corner
- Use a daybed for flexible seating
- Keep walkways clear by pushing furniture against walls
Visual Magic: Making Small Feel Spacious
Light and Reflection are Your Superpowers
- Hang a massive mirror – it’s like creating an instant window
- Choose light, airy colors (bye-bye, dark and dreary!)
- Try the “pattern drenching” technique – one bold pattern can actually make a room feel larger
Storage Solutions That Actually Work
Nobody wants a cluttered bedroom. These hacks will save you:
Clever Storage Strategies:
- Build shelves around your bed
- Use floating shelves instead of bulky nightstands
- Invest in slim, leggy furniture that keeps floor space open
Lighting: The Unsung Hero of Small Spaces
Lighting can totally transform a tiny room:
- Install wall sconces to free up bedside tables
- Use sheer curtains to maximize natural light
- Add dimmable lights for mood and depth

Budget-Friendly Transformation Hacks
You don’t need a fortune to make magic happen:
- Repurpose baskets and crates for storage
- Use wall hooks creatively
- Shop second-hand for unique, affordable pieces
Common Tiny Bedroom Mistakes to Dodge
Avoid These Pitfalls:
- Overcrowding with bulky furniture
- Using dark, heavy color schemes
- Ignoring vertical space potential
